Understanding Meta's Evolving Stance on AI Superintelligence and Open Source The world of Artificial Intelligence is evolving at an unprecedented pace, with advancements seemingly happening daily. For many, the concept of "superintelligence" might sound like something out of science fiction, yet tech giants are now openly discussing its imminent arrival. What exactly is personal superintelligence, and how does it relate to the open-source movement in AI? Simply put, personal superintelligence envisions AI tools so powerful they can help individuals achieve their most ambitious personal goals. Historically, Meta, led by CEO Mark Zuckerberg, has been a strong proponent of open-sourcing its AI models, notably the Llama family, aiming to democratize access to cutting-edge AI. This approach has been a key differentiator from competitors like OpenAI and Google DeepMind, who largely keep their models closed.
